Interactions between parasites and pollutants in yellow perch (Perca flavescens) in the St. Lawrence River, Canada: implications for resistance and tolerance to parasites

Abstract
Parasites were examined in yellow perch, Perca flavescens (Mitchill, 1814), from four localities ranging in degree of pollution in the St. Lawrence River, Quebec, Canada, to examine the effects of the most prevalent parasite species on expression of biomarkers of oxidative stress. Various biomarkers appeared to be affected by the infection levels of Apophallus brevis Ransom, 1920 and genus Diplostomum von Nordmann, 1832. For certain biomarkers, interactions between infection level and pollution type were detected for A. brevis, Diplostomum spp., and genus Ichthyocotylurus Odening, 1969. Activity of glutathione reductase in gill tissue decreased with increasing numbers of A. brevis, but only at the two most polluted localities. Catalase activity in kidney increased with numbers of Diplostomum spp. at the polluted localities, but not at the two least contaminated sites. Results suggest that parasites may affect expression of biomarkers of pollution and that pathogenicity of parasites may be enhanced under polluted conditions. Exposure to contaminants appears to reduce tolerance, but not resistance, to parasites in yellow perch in this system. This type of immunosuppression may be widespread in polluted ecosystems.
